The LOUDfence on St. Patrick’s Catholic Cathedral in Ballarat has been there for nearly 10 years. Initial attempts to remove the ribbons saw a public outcry with LOUDfence supporters restoring the fence. The message for institutions is to own your LOUDfence or it will own you.

A LOUDfence is a public expression of grief and dismay when institutions repeatedly fail in their duty to protect children in their care.

LOUDfence is a grassroots international movement dedicated to raising awareness of widespread child sexual abuse in our communities and the lifelong harms it causes. Each ribbon gives a voice to a victim silenced and seeks to reduce the stigma they often experience in later life.
